Leaky boot.
Hi
It's sometime since I visited here, but that's not because I have sold the Rover of 19 years. She is still trucking on and has covered 137000 miles from new. (One owner me). I thought I had cured all the leaks on the notoriously leaky Rover75, but I am having extreme difficulty in sourcing the boot leak. There is no water in the tyre well and I know it's not the rear light cluster, the trim holes along the rear wings, or the rectangular vents. The water drips from above onto a large plastic tray that I have strategically positioned in the boot. Initially it was coming from the left hand side, but lately I've had drips from the right hand side. From my description above I believe that there are only 2 other options and that's the back window seal, or the sunroof drains, but my money is on the back window seal , that is showing it's age. What are my options to repair this? Has anyone fixed a back window seal leak? |
